A typical Radiofrequency (RF) treatment is a structured, non-invasive process designed to stimulate collagen production through controlled heating. The procedure follows a strict protocol: a consultation to assess goals, skin preparation to remove barriers like oils, the application of a conductive gel, and the systematic use of the RF device for 30 to 60 minutes. While the treatment is generally comfortable with minimal downtime, it requires specific pre-session compliance and post-treatment care to ensure safety and efficacy.
RF therapy is not a "one-and-done" event but a cumulative process that relies on a specific treatment series. While the session itself involves a manageable warming sensation, the real work happens afterward as collagen rebuilds over time, requiring adherence to a multi-week schedule for lasting results.
The Pre-Treatment Phase
The Initial Consultation
Before any device touches your skin, a consultation with a qualified professional is mandatory. This step establishes your specific skin concerns and defines the goals of the therapy.
Essential Skin Preparation
To ensure the RF energy penetrates effectively, the skin must be a blank canvas. The practitioner will prep the area by thoroughly removing makeup, natural oils, and surface debris.
Pre-Session Restrictions
Although often marketed as "no preparation," the primary protocols dictate specific cautions. Your practitioner may provide instructions to avoid sun exposure or discontinue certain medications prior to the appointment to minimize sensitivity.
Inside the Treatment Session
Application of Conductive Medium
Once the skin is clean, a specialized gel is applied to the treatment area. This acts as a coupling agent, ensuring the RF energy is delivered smoothly into the dermis without scattering or burning the surface.
Device Usage and Adjustments
The practitioner applies the RF device to the skin, moving it across the target area. Crucially, device settings are not static; they are adjusted throughout the session based on skin response and tolerance.
Sensation and Timing
You can expect a warming, soothing sensation rather than sharp pain. A typical session lasts between 30 and 60 minutes, depending on the surface area being treated.
Understanding the Trade-offs
Immediate vs. Cumulative Results
You may notice an immediate "lift" or glow right after the session, but do not mistake this for the final result. True structural change requires a series of treatments over several weeks to rebuild collagen levels.
The "No Downtime" Nuance
While the primary expectation is an immediate return to normal activities, "no downtime" does not mean "no reaction." You may experience tenderness, redness, or swelling. This is a normal inflammatory response indicating the skin is healing and tightening.
Activity Restrictions
Despite the ability to return to work, you must avoid specific environments to prevent adverse effects. Heat-inducing activities, such as vigorous workouts or saunas, should be avoided for roughly two days to prevent increased swelling.
Making the Right Choice for Your Goal
To maximize the investment in RF therapy, align your expectations and aftercare with your specific objectives.
- If your primary focus is immediate visual improvement: Acknowledge that the post-treatment "glow" and lift are temporary bonuses; lasting tightness requires the full treatment course.
- If your primary focus is long-term skin health: Commit to the recommended schedule of sessions over several weeks to allow collagen to naturally rebuild.
- If your primary focus is safety and recovery: Strictly follow the 5-day aftercare rule: use gentle cleansers, hydrate with serums, and avoid chemical exfoliants for at least two weeks.
Successful RF treatment relies as much on your adherence to aftercare protocols as it does on the technology itself.
Summary Table:
| Phase | Duration | Key Actions | Expected Sensation |
|---|---|---|---|
| Preparation | 5-10 Mins | Consultation, cleansing, & conductive gel application | Cool & soothing |
| Active Treatment | 30-60 Mins | Controlled RF energy delivery via handpiece | Deep warming/Heat |
| Post-Session | 5-10 Mins | Skin soothing & aftercare briefing | Mild redness/Glow |
| Recovery | 2-48 Hours | Avoid heat, sun, & intense exercise | Slight tenderness |
